4. Steps to Perform Manual Key Entry
Entering your Skoda Fabia Manual Key Entry Fabia manually involves straightforward steps. Here’s how to do it:
-
Locate the Key Blade: If the key fob battery has actually passed away, extract the key blade from the remote key fob by pushing the designated button or slider.
-
Open the Door:
- Approach the motorist’s side door.
- Place the key blade into the door lock cylinder.
- Turn the key to the right (or left, depending on the model) to unlock.
-
(Mock Image URL)Open the Door: Once opened, pull the door manage to open.
-
Access the Vehicle: After entering, you can either drive the car or attend to the hidden issue (like replacing the fob battery).

-
Beginning the Engine: If necessary, insert the key blade into the ignition slot and turn it to begin the car.
5. Typical Challenges and Troubleshooting
While manual key entry is designed to be user-friendly, problems can periodically develop. Here are some common difficulties and their options:
| Issue | Service |
|---|---|
| Key fob not responding | Change the key fob battery |
| Key blade stuck in door lock | Lube the lock and carefully totally free the blade |
| Ignition won’t turn | Confirm the key blade is the right one and try once again |
| Key fob split or damaged | Get a replacement key fob from a dealership |
